Guy Penrod: A Southern Gospel Legend

Guy Penrod, born on February 7, 1963, in Abilene, Texas, is a renowned southern gospel singer who has made a significant impact on the music industry. With his powerful vocals and heartfelt performances, Guy has captivated audiences around the world for decades. His career, which spans over three decades, is filled with numerous milestones and achievements that have solidified his place as a true gospel music legend.

Early Life and Career Beginnings

As a young man, Guy Penrod discovered his passion for music and began honing his craft. He attended Liberty University in Virginia, where he studied music and developed his vocal talents. After graduating, Guy embarked on his professional career, working as a backup singer for some of the biggest names in the industry, including Amy Grant and Garth Brooks. His soulful voice and charismatic stage presence quickly caught the attention of music enthusiasts and industry professionals alike.

Joining the Gaither Vocal Band

In 1994, Guy Penrod joined the renowned Gaither Vocal Band, a prestigious southern gospel group led by gospel music icon Bill Gaither. Guy's addition to the band brought a new dynamic and energy to their performances, earning him widespread acclaim and recognition. During his tenure with the Gaither Vocal Band, Guy recorded several albums, including the critically acclaimed "God Is Good," "Give It Away," and "I Do Believe."

Solo Success and Musical Journey

In addition to his work with the Gaither Vocal Band, Guy Penrod also pursued a successful solo career. Between 2005 and 2012, he released a series of solo albums, including "Breathe Deep" and "Hymns." These albums showcased Guy's versatility as a performer and his ability to connect with audiences on a personal and emotional level. His solo work further solidified his reputation as a talented and versatile artist in the gospel music genre.

Family Life and Personal Endeavors

Despite his demanding career, Guy Penrod always prioritized his family. He is married to his wife Angie, and together they have seven sons and one daughter. Guy's commitment to his family is evident in the way he balances his professional endeavors with his personal life, showing that he values his loved ones above all else. This dedication to family has endeared him to fans and admirers, who see him as a role model both on and off the stage.
